摘要
目的:了解自然老化对内着色SY-1硅橡胶色彩稳定性的影响,以便为选用适宜的硅橡胶着色颜料提供理论依据。方法:SY-1硅橡胶按所加色料不同分为4组(对照组、水粉颜料土黄色、油画颜料土黄色、无机盐类颜料中铬黄),按国家标准对其进行自然老化同时避光保存并测定老化前后L*、a*、b*值,据此计算DE值。结果:经避光保存6个月,对照组△E为0.78±0.02;水粉土黄组DE为3.95±0.40;油画土黄组DE为2.0±0.12;中铬黄组DE为1.4±0.07。经自然老化6个月,对照组DE为1.32±0.01;水粉土黄组DE为6.69±0.12;油画土黄组DE1.79±0.42;中铬黄组DE为20.14±0.13。结论:SY-1硅橡胶在自然老化条件下,油画类颜料色彩稳定性优于水粉颜料和无机盐类颜料。
Objective: To explore into the effects of ozone aging factors on the color stability of the SY-1 siliconeelastomer so as to select the best pigments for clinical application. Methods: Consulting 1976 CIE LAB standards ofchromatic aberration, we analyzed the effects of ozone aging on the color stability of SY-1 silicone elastomers paintedwith three color series (control, gouache color, oil pigment and inorganic salts). Results : Under the timepass conditionfor six month ,the DE of control is 0.78±0.02, gouache color was 3.95±0.40 oil pigment was 2.0±0.12; inorganicsalts was 1.4±0.07 respectively; Under the nature condition for six month ,the DE of control was 1.32±0.01, gouachecolor was 6.69±0.12 oil pigment was 1.79±0.42; inorganic salts was 20.14±0.13 respectively. Conclusion: Underthe nature aging condition, the SY-1 silicone elastomers stained with oil pigment showed better color stability than thatwith gouache color and inorganic salts.
